1. Glassnode

Glassnode, which specializes in on-chain data analytics, focuses on in-depth analysis and metrics for leading blockchain ecosystems and c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um. It creates rigorous enterprise-grade analytics for multiple blockchain data points – analyzing network health, Bitcoin and Ethereum exchange in/out metrics, holder behavior, and other supply metrics.

.Glassnode

Visibility of these metrics on price charts is non-existent. With respect to long-term blockchain behavior analytics, traders, analysts, and financial institutions use their charts and recommendations for investment strategy formulation, market cycle analytics, and macro trend analysis. Their data sets provide the foundation for market forecasting and strategic frameworks.

2. Arkham Intelligence

Arkham Intelligence employs sophisticated technologies for entity clustering and attribution to further meaning to previously unprocessed data regarding blockchain activity. Rather than merely presenting data about transactions, Arkham tries to associate wallet addresses with known entities, such as exchanges, hedge funds, whale wallets, or wallets associated with hackers.

Arkham Intelligence

The combination of this entity-level analysis and configurable dashboards, exchange flow tracking, intelligence alerts, and an intelligence marketplace provides researchers and analysts with greater clarity about the individuals behind the movement of money, and the extent to which large, on-chain flows are related to market activity. The real-time capabilities are particularly valuable for investigations that are happening quickly and for transparency dashboards.

3. Dune Analytics

Dune Analytics is a blockchain analytical platform based on community collaboration. Users can create custom SQL queries on indexed blockchain data and then create visualizations and dashboards.

.Dune Analytics

The platform supports various chains and gives researchers, developers, and analysts the flexibility to access and examine data related to DeFi, NFTs, governance, tokens, and more.

- Advertisement -

While other dashboards rely on pre-installed queries, Dune thrives on flexibility. The community approach means users can make and share queries. The extensive collection of community analytics Dune offers fosters rapid development of decentralized analytics and exploration.

4. Elliptic

Elliptic develops compliance-centric blockchain analytics for financial institutions and regulators to identify and mitigate risks associated with financial crime. Its platform provides sophisticated transaction monitoring, risk scoring of wallets and addresses, sanctions screening, and anti-money laundering (AML) tools for organizations to detect and manage regulatory compliance associated with illicit activities.

Elliptic

By evaluating the risk of high exposure to a given entity and offering comprehensive risk assessments, Elliptic facilitates secure digital asset use and compliance with applicable regulatory requirements. This is especially beneficial to the compliance, fintech, and crypto custody sectors

5.Nansen

Nansen is an analytics platform powered by Artificial Intelligence and direct integration to the blockchain to provide wallet labeling and smart money analytics which define and follow the market activities of key players and their on-chain actions.

Nansen

Nansen’s proprietary wallet classification and real-time data analytics is combined to study the patterns of interaction of the most dominant, whale, and strategic holders of tokens, different DeFi protocols, and the NFT market. Nansen’s customers can study the state of the tokens, liquidity, sector, and the entire balance sheet of multiple blockchains.

Nansen is valuable to traders, developers of new Web3 businesses, and analysts in user research, as it can provide valuable market insights before other competitors.

6. CryptoQuant

CryptoQuant gives users a variety of data on the state of the blockchain and the state of the market both in real-time and historically. They leverage trader, investor, and institutional behavioral data and on-chain data such as flow of cryptocurrencies to the exchanges, miner data, network data, derivatives, and liquidity to identify trends in cryptocurrencies and forecast price changes.

CryptoQuant

They also offer features like pre-built dashboards, APIs, adjustable alerts, and no-code analytics to make their features as easy to use as possible. They help streamline the analytics process so users can make more insightful, evidence-based decisions.

7. CipherTrace

Using blockchain technology for the first time, CipherTrace launched one of the first bitcoin transaction tracking services, focusing on anti-money laundering, fraud detection, and financial investigations for Anti-Money Laundering (AML) compliance for banks, cryptocurrency exchanges, wallets, and regulators.

CipherTrace

It also allows banks and other financial institutions to trace, score, and analyze financial risk and compliance via blockchain technology to track and analyze financial transactions to oversee the flow of digital assets and evaluate the legitimacy of cryptocurrency addresses to validate compliance with the legal limitations of the address.

CipherTrace’s tools help recognize the presence of suspicious or fraudulent cryptocurrency transactions to foster a safer and more transparent environment for fraudulent cryptocurrencies. Other tools also cross-chain tracking to trace suspicious fraudulent transactions.

While some of the individual products have changed over time, the core of CipherTrace has remained the same which is to combat all financial crimes and also to protect the cryptocurrency industry.

10. Santiment

Santiment provides an integrated view of blockchain data along with social and dev data resulting in more behavioral insights than competitors in the cryptocurrency markets.

In addition to the on-chain metrics, such as transaction activity and distribution of tokens, Santiment examines the social side, analyzing developer activity along with the community and social trends to reveal mood changes that historically precede price changes.

Santiment

The Santiment platform comes with alerts and watchlists, along with custom charting to help traders and analysts get a more nuanced view of the markets. Combining sentiment signals with technical signals, Santiment enables a more accurate assessment of the crowd’s psychology and assists in identifying story-driven price movements.
